About

Paula Teves‐Costa is a scholar working on Geophysics, Civil and Structural Engineering and Ocean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Paula Teves‐Costa has authored 29 papers receiving a total of 602 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 24 papers in Geophysics, 14 papers in Civil and Structural Engineering and 2 papers in Ocean Engineering. Recurrent topics in Paula Teves‐Costa’s work include earthquake and tectonic studies (17 papers), Geological and Geophysical Studies Worldwide (14 papers) and Seismic Performance and Analysis (13 papers). Paula Teves‐Costa is often cited by papers focused on earthquake and tectonic studies (17 papers), Geological and Geophysical Studies Worldwide (14 papers) and Seismic Performance and Analysis (13 papers). Paula Teves‐Costa collaborates with scholars based in Portugal, France and Italy. Paula Teves‐Costa's co-authors include José Fernando Borges, Josep Batlló, Luís Matias, Mourad Bezzeghoud, Pierre‐Yves Bard, Daniel Stich, Ramón Macià, J. Morales, Fabrizio Cara and Bertrand Guillier and has published in prestigious journals such as Tectonophysics, Geophysical Journal International and Bulletin of the Seismological Society of America.
